Feasible websites of origin consist of the choroid plexus, the ependyma, and the parenchyma. Anatomically, choroid plexus cells is floating in the cerebrospinal liquid of the lateral, 3rd, and also 4th ventricles. This tissue is well perfused by numerous villi, each having a main capillary with fenestrated endothelium. This uncommon cellular makeup creates the blood CSF barrier identified by limited junctions at the apical end of the choroid epithelial cells instead of at the capillary endothelium within each villus. The major functions of CSF are to cushion the mind and spine when they're struck with mechanical pressure, to offer standard immunological defense to the CNS, to eliminate metabolic waste, as well as to deliver neuromodulators as well as neurotransmitters. CSF is likewise really helpful for professional diagnosis, as well as its samples are usually obtained from the subarachnoid room by back puncture. It has commonly been thought that CSF is absorbed via little, specific cell clusters called arachnoid villi near the top and also midline of the mind. The CSF after that goes through the arachnoid villi into the remarkable sagittal sinus, a large blood vessel, and is taken in right into the bloodstream. Once in the bloodstream, it is brought away and also filteringed system by the kidneys and also liver in the same way as various other physical fluids. Elevation of ICP may also result from enhanced CSF quantity such as hydrocephalus. Many cases of hydrocephalus are triggered by blockage of CSF flow-most frequently from mind tumors and aqueductal sores. Nonobstructive hydrocephalus may be caused by lowered CSF absorption, such as in sinovenous thrombosis and also problems that create marked elevation of CSF protein, such as the Guillain-Barré disorder, as well as, hardly ever, by CSF oversecretion by choroid plexus lumps

Relocating tissue such as CSF causes changing of the phase of the rotating protons. The stage shifting can be determined and also qualitative instructions of flow and measurable flow velocity can be determined making use of a PC strategy. The flow of CSF via the aqueduct of Sylvius, basal cisterns, and foramen magnum typically changes instructions 2 or three times per 2nd, with a web slow-moving circulation in the superior to inferior direction. Heart gating can be carried out with the PC technique, as well as flow information can be figured out at selected intervals during the cardiac cycle. This flow info can be presented in a cine loop, demonstrating the temporal and also spatial changes of CSF flow.

Ependymomas are the 3rd most usual pediatric brain growths but only make up 1.9% of grown-up primary mind growths. They are CNS malignancies that stem from the ependymal cell cellular lining of the ventricles. Subependymomas, also known as THAT grade I ependymomas, mostly occur within the fourth ventricle or the lateral ventricles. They are defined histologically by a nodular pattern with zones of raised nuclear density or fibrillary stroma.Although these growths are very treatable, there are often long lasting morbidities from surgical procedure to remove these tumors.

CSF can be tested for the diagnosis of numerous neurological illness, typically with a procedure called lumbar leak. Back puncture is carried out in an attempt to count the cells in the fluid and also to identify the levels of protein and also glucose. These parameters alone might be incredibly advantageous in the medical diagnosis of subarachnoid hemorrhage and also CNS infections such as meningitis.
